Mercedes ML270 Overview

The Mercedes ML 270 is a 4x4 luxury SUV (Sports Utility Vehicle) produced by the German automobile manufacturer Mercedes-Benz. This vehicle shares the design platform of the GL-Class, which is the slightly larger vehicle and slots in between the GL-Class and smaller GLK-Class of Mercedes vehicles. The Mercedes ML270 are very luxurious and spacious inside and also look really classy. For the type of vehicle, they are not as costly as one would expect. They are good off-road but could be a lot better on-road. Not as reliable as would be expected from a Mercedes.

Mercedes ML270 History

The Mercedes ML 270 is part of the M-Series Mercedes 4x4 vehicles. The M-Series was first produced in 1997, after an extensive work by Mercedes to produce a luxury SUV to replace the previous G-Class. The first M-Class came off the production line in 1997, and was the first luxury SUV to feature electronic stability control and had front and side airbags as standard. This vehicle faired extremely well in safety tests. The first generation (1997-2005) M-Class was to be the only generation which would feature the ML 270, which was CDI diesel version. The first ML 270 was produced in 1998 for the European market, featuring a turbo diesel engine. It was also sold in Australia, and continued to be produced until 2005, when the second generation M-Series was introduced and this version was discontinued.

Fuel Economy

As this is a 2.7 turbo diesel version of the M-Class series, it is pretty big on fuel due to the fact that the engine is pulling a 2 tonne vehicle around, on and off road. Compared with similar vehicles of this class, it compares pretty well economically, and due to the fact it is a diesel, it fairs well compared to other versions of the M-Class. Overall, expect to pay a lot for fuel.

Transmission

There are two gearboxes available for this vehicle: 5-speed manual and 5-speed 5G-tronic automatic. There is a section of our website dedicated to Mercedes gearboxes. Have a look to find your gearbox parts.
